Diaz surprises design class
Cameron Diaz surprised a class at Stanford University when she helped lead a lecture on environmentally friendly design.
Diazâs appearance came as part of taping for mtvU programme Stand-In in which celebrities teach a class.
Earlier this week, Madonna lectured students at New Yorkâs Hunter College.
A champion of environmental causes, Diaz served as a sidekick for her friend and environmental architect William McDonough, a consulting professor at Stanford, California.
âHeâs very charismatic, captivating,â Diaz said of McDonough, who Time magazine once called âHero for the Planetâ.
âBill is one of those people who is thinking big, but is also producing.â
Students gasped and giggled when Diaz interrupted the class during McDonoughâs lecture, and later lined up to snap pictures with the actress on their cell phones.
